How do I add my other calendars to Brain in Hand?

At the moment, you can add your Google and Outlook calendars so they integrate with your Brain in Hand diary, allowing you to see all your events in one place. We're working on supporting other types of calendars in future.

 

Once you've brought a Google or Outlook calendar into Brain in Hand, you can add helpful solutions to the events within it. If you then want to edit or delete an event, you'll need to do it within the Google calendar itself (there's an icon on each event that links out to it).

 

How to add a calendar 

You'll see the option to add a Google or Outlook calendar on the home screen (and on any days in your diary that have no events yet) as well as in your settings. When you select the calendar you want to add, you'll see a summary of the information we'll need to access. You'll need to select 'Allow' to add your calendar and see it in your diary.

 

Adding a calendar only brings events into Brain in Hand, NOT the other way around. When you add a calendar, you won't see the reminders you'd normally receive for that calendar inside Brain in Hand, but we'll be introducing that feature soon.

 

How to remove a calendar

If you add a calendar but change your mind later, it's easy to undo the process. You can do this from the settings screen in the app.

 

Removing the calendar will remove the events and associated problems and solutions from your Brain in Hand diary but you will still see your event names on your Timeline. 

 

About your data

We'll only use the information from a calendar that you add for the purpose of adding and managing it in your diary. We won't use it for anything else.

Adding other calendars

This feature works for Google and Outlook calendars and we're working on aupporting more calendars in the future. In the meantime, if you want to use another type of calendar, you could first link it to your Google calendar, then synchronise that with Brain in Hand.
